Daily Operations Procedure: How to Add New Knowledge Base Articles
Purpose: Standardize how internal wiki articles are created, organized, reviewed, and published.
Most WordPress knowledge base plugins allow administrators to create articles through the WordPress dashboard using a dedicated “Knowledge Base” menu. Articles are typically assigned to categories/sections so employees can easily find information.

Creating a New Knowledge Base Article
Step 1 — Login to WordPress Admin
- Open the WordPress administration portal.
- Login using your assigned office administrator account.
- Navigate to the Dashboard.
Step 2 — Open Knowledge Base
From the left-side menu:
Knowledge Base → Add New Article
(The exact wording may vary depending on the installed plugin. Many plugins use options such as “Add New Article” or “Knowledge Base → Add New.”)
Step 3 — Create Article Title
The title should clearly explain what the article covers.
Good Examples:
✅ How To Create A New Customer Account
✅ Employee Vacation Request Process
✅ Vehicle Daily Inspection Procedure
✅ How To Submit A Purchase Order
Avoid:
❌ Important Information
❌ New Process
❌ Read This
❌ Update
The title should allow employees to find the article through search.

Step 5 — Write Article Content
Use the company standard format.
Article Template
Purpose
Explain why this procedure exists.
Example:
This article explains the process for creating a new customer record to ensure all customer information is accurately entered into company systems.
Procedure
List steps in order.
Example:
- Login to the customer management system.
- Select “New Customer.”
- Enter customer contact information.
- Confirm address and service details.
- Save the customer profile.
Important Notes
Include warnings, requirements, or exceptions.
Example:
- Do not create duplicate customer profiles.
- Verify customer phone numbers before saving.
- Only authorized employees may modify billing information.
Related Articles
Link supporting documents.
Example:
- Customer Billing Procedure
- New Client Setup Checklist
- CRM User Guide

Step 7 — Review Before Publishing
Before publishing, confirm:
☐ Correct category selected
☐ Title is clear
☐ Instructions are accurate
☐ Spelling checked
☐ Links work
☐ Screenshots are updated
☐ No confidential information included
Step 8 — Publish Article
When complete:
- Select Publish
- Confirm article visibility settings.
- Verify the article appears correctly in the knowledge base.
Article Naming Standards
Use this format:
[Department] – [Process Name]
Examples:
- Office Administration – Creating New Customer Accounts
- HR – Employee Onboarding Process
- Finance – Invoice Approval Procedure
- Safety – Daily Vehicle Inspection Requirements
Updating Existing Articles
When changing an existing article:
- Open the article.
- Review previous content.
- Update only required sections.
- Add the update date.
- Save changes.
- Notify affected departments if the change impacts operations.
Knowledge Base Quality Standards
Every ValueBrands knowledge base article should be:
Simple
Written so a new employee can understand it.
Action-Based
Employees should know exactly what to do.
Current
Outdated procedures must be updated or removed.
Consistent
All departments should follow the same documentation style.
